Protein Function
Promotes orthogonal branching of actin filaments and
links actin filaments to membrane glycoproteins. Anchors various
transmembrane proteins to the actin cytoskeleton and serves as a
scaffold for a wide range of cytoplasmic signaling proteins.
Interaction with FLNA may allow neuroblast migration from the
ventricular zone into the cortical plate. Tethers cell surface-
localized furin, modulates its rate of internalization and directs
its intracellular trafficking (By similarity). Involved in
ciliogenesis. Plays a role in cell-cell contacts and adherens
junctions during the development of blood vessels, heart and brain
organs. Plays a role in platelets morphology through interaction
with SYK that regulates ITAM- and ITAM-like-containing receptor
signaling, resulting in by platelet cytoskeleton organization
maintenance (By similarity).
